Barzman examines the academic confraternal and guild practices of artists in Florence from the mid-sixteenth to the mid-eighteenth century. By analyzing production reception and patronage associated with the concept disegno this study links changes in artistic practice to shifts in the political fortunes of the Tuscan Grand Dukes.
